Flying High: Airline News

Spanish airline Iberia is interested in opening a direct flight from Guadalajara to Madrid, according to Jalisco Tourism Secretary Enrique Ramos. 

Ramos said he recently met with the president of the airline to discuss the idea.  Not only residents of Jalisco, but those living in Nayarit, Aguascalientes, Colima and Michoacan, would prefer to fly directly to Europe from Guadalajara rather than via Mexico City. Ramos said. 

Low-cost Mexican carrier Volaris begins its direct flights from Guadalajara to Miami International Airport on February 1. There will be four flights each week.

New connections from international destinations to Puerto Vallarta include a direct flight from Helskini, Finland. Other routes under discussion are Amsterdam and Frankfurt.
